Sean showed how evil can break promises and that is what's happening today. But in terms of writing, the way I improve my work is I copywork. What is that? I take great writing or literature and copy word-for-word front to back over and over. And let me tell you (actually this comment can tell you) it has worked for me. Hunter S. Thompson, while working for Time Mag, snuck in the books Great Gatsby and A Farewell to Arms, copied all their work to see what it was like to be the writer. Any one who reads this comment maybe should try copyworking. But I agree with Andrew: don't PLAGIARIZE. It's just wrong and illegal. Writers can sue.
